WeatherShield vs Marine Vinyl: Which Is Right for You?
WeatherShield covers
WeatherShield fabric is a high-performance 100% polyester material designed to outperform traditional vinyl covers in durability, weight, and long-term usability.
Why choose WeatherShield?
WeatherShield offers several key advantages over standard marine vinyl:
Significantly lighter – up to 25% reduction in overall cover weight
Easier handling and reduced strain on cover lifters
Up to 3× stronger than traditional vinyl
Excellent tear and abrasion resistance
PU-coated for reliable waterproof protection
Made from recyclable materials
Performance & durability
WeatherShield is engineered for long-term outdoor performance:
Highly durable: superior resistance to tearing, abrasion, and daily wear
All-weather protection: excellent resistance to UV, moisture, and mildew
Dimensionally stable: does not shrink, stretch, or deform over time
Long-lasting flexibility: maintains structure and performance for years
WeatherShield vs. marine vinyl
WeatherShield
Lightweight and easy to handle
More resistant to tearing and environmental stress
Maintains flexibility over time
Minimal maintenance required
Longer overall lifespan
Marine vinyl
Proven and widely used material
Good UV and water resistance
Easy to clean
Heavier construction
May crack, shrink, or become brittle over time, especially under harsh conditions
